Understanding Career Reinvention: A Brief Background

Career reinvention is not a new phenomenon. Historically, many individuals have had to switch careers due to significant changes in the job market, such as industrialization and automation. However, the pace of change in the modern world has made career reinvention more common. This process involves a significant shift in profession, requiring individuals to acquire new skills and knowledge to succeed in a different industry or role.

The 21st-century job market is characterized by rapid technological advancements, resulting in new career opportunities in areas like data science, cybersecurity, and sustainability. Simultaneously, traditional roles are becoming obsolete due to automation and digitization. Therefore, a career reinvention is no longer an exception but a necessity for many professionals.

Real-world Applications of Career Strategy

Strategic career reinvention involves identifying transferable skills, leveraging existing networks for opportunities, and continuous learning. For instance, a journalist wanting to transition into digital marketing might leverage their writing skills, learn about SEO strategies, and use their network to find opportunities in the new field.
